Pahoa Regional Town Center Plan: The AC discussed the status of the Pahoa Regional <br /> Town Center Plan project, including options and recommendations to the Planning Director for <br /> moving forward. <br /> Public Testimony: <br /> 1. Mark Hinshaw, member of the Pahoa Regional Town Center Subcommittee, testified on <br /> his frustration that the three ordinances were pulled from the Planning Commissions <br /> Agenda. He would like to continue pushing forward with the ordinances and urged the <br /> AC to support their efforts. If the ordinances are approved, they can be amended if <br /> need be with regards to the lava and the impact it will have on Pahoa. Mark stressed the <br /> need to have these ordinances come before the Planning Commission. <br /> Larry noted that the next Planning Committee meeting is on November 3rd and this would be <br /> the next opportunity for the ordinances to be on the agenda. There are valid concerns about the <br /> impact the lava will have on Pahoa. Rene agrees with Mark that no matter how the flow bisects <br /> Pahoa the design guidelines would be valid on both sides of the flow. By not pushing forward <br /> we may be giving more people an opportunity to take advantage of the situation. After some <br /> discussion it was decided that the AC would draft a letter to send to the Planning Director. <br /> Sharon moved to table agenda item 9 until the end of the meeting. Second by Leila. The <br /> motion passed with 9 votes aye and 0 votes nay. <br /> After the last agenda item was discussed, Sharon moved to bring agenda item 9 back to the <br /> table. Second by Leila. The motion passed with 9 votes aye and 0 votes nay. <br /> Oshi moved that the AC accept a draft letter to the Planning Department, Councilperson Zendo <br /> Kern and Councilperson Greggor Ragan regarding the Pahoa Plan and related ordinances. <br /> Second by Sharon. <br /> The letter is as follows: <br /> To: Duane Kanuha, Zendo Kern, Greggor Illagan <br /> From: Patti Pinto, Chair <br /> PCDP AC <br /> Re: An ordinance amending Chapter 25, HCC, establishing the Pahoa Village <br /> District as a special district under article 7. <br /> An ordinance amending Chapter 25, HCC,relating to the review applications for <br /> Plan Approval and Planned Unit Development projects in special districts with <br /> adopted design guidelines. <br /> An ordinance amending Chapter 3, HCC relating to the regulation of signs in the <br /> Pahoa Village District. <br /> The Action Committee of the Puna Community Development Plan urges you to support <br /> the placement of the three ordinances intended to create the Pahoa Village Design <br /> District that are necessary to implement the Design Guidelines on the County Council <br /> agenda at the earliest possible time. <br /> These ordinances continue to be urgently needed to guide development in Pahoa <br /> especially in these times of uncertainty and the relocation of businesses. <br />
